Output 31d580b8b97b24c19202165d328cc47fc7699df4c1e00a893c7c9e713679898e:1

value
22415533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3818afc081110c3899e9fb5cb37f38cd844912c6 OP_EQUAL
address
MD1meRV3GPmKMfrjrKuA4MfMNAZ8wEb6Vz
transaction
31d580b8b97b24c19202165d328cc47fc7699df4c1e00a893c7c9e713679898e
spent
true